If you grew up in the 1990s, chances are you've seen Happy Gilmore, the Adam Sandler flick where he's a goofy, uncouth golf player (rather than a goofy, uncouth elementary-school student or a goofy, uncouth role model). And if you have set foot on a golf course since then, chances are you've attempted the famous Happy Gilmore golf swing.

Of course, you might have missed the tee on your running drive through the box — golf is tricky, after all. But you're not the top golfer in the world, like child-of-the-'90s Jordan Spieth is. Here's Spieth teeing off Sunday at the 70th Grapefruit Pro-Am in Florida:
